Learn about Hayti's Blues Festival, kids production of the Wiz, Poetry Slams and more.

Strong communities need strong community centers, and the Hayti Heritage Center is just that for many in Durham. The Director Angela Lee joins Literary Artist and Educator Dasan Ahanu to talk about the Hayti's history, current programs, and upcoming event, including the ANFO production of "The Wiz", science camp, Thursday night Poetry Slams, and the 27th Annual Bull Durham Blues Festival.
